Actor and Author Capt. Dale A. Dye Returns to the Black Sands of Iwo Jima for The Armory Life

The Armory Life™ is proud to announce that respected military consultant, actor, director and writer Capt. Dale Dye, USMC (Ret) has authored an article on World War II’s Battle of Iwo Jima, commemorating the 79th anniversary of this pivotal battle that began on February 19th, 1945. In this piece, he recounts one of the U.S. Marine Corps’ most revered, yet costly victories.

Beginning with his first trip as a young Marine in the mid-1960s, Capt. Dye has visited that hallowed ground three times. Over these visits, he was able to climb to the location of the famed flag raising on Mount Suribachi, viewing from that vantage point infamous battle sites such as the Quarry, the Amphitheater, Turkey Knob, Hills 362A, B and C, and the Motoyama airstrips.

During his time there, he explored many of these sites as well as crawled through caves packed with rusty weapons, ammo and little housekeeping items left by the men who fought and died there. On one visit, he was able to find rare porcelain mess tins marked with the anchor and rising sun symbol of the Rikusentai, or Japanese Special Naval Landing Force. Read more

InfiRay Outdoor Announces the FINDER V2 640 35mm Thermal Rangefinder (FH35RV2)

iRayUSA, the United States Distributor of InfiRay Outdoor thermal optics, introduces the FINDER V2 – a handheld 640-resolution thermal monocular with an integrated laser rangefinder.

The InfiRay Outdoor FINDER V2 combines a powerful thermal viewer with a handheld laser rangefinder, giving hunters the ability to identify targets at night and accurately determine their range. A 640×512 thermal sensor paired with a 3× 35 mm f/0.9 lens provides a crisp image with ample room for digital zoom, ideal for viewing wildlife or recording photos and videos. The FINDER V2 pairs 800-yard infrared laser rangefinding capability (continuous or single capture) with a 1,750-yard thermal detection range in a compact unit that fits in the palm of your hand. The FINDER V2 ships with two IBP-2 batteries, each providing 3+ hours of run time. A proximity sensor automatically powers off the display when moved away from the viewer’s eye to reduce power consumption and visible light signature.

The new FINDER V2 (FH35RV2) launches with an ultra-competitive price of $2,499. Read more

Help Stop Invasive Species During National Invasive Species Awareness Week

National Invasive Species Awareness Week is an international annual event held February 26 through March 3, 2024, looking to raise awareness about invasive species, the threat they pose, and what can do together to prevent their spread. In support of NISAW, the Michigan Department of Agriculture and Rural Development is encouraging all Michiganders to do their part to prevent the spread of invasive species.

Invasive species are plants, animals, insects, and pathogens not native to an area and can cause serious harm to the environment, economy, agriculture, or public health. These pests often are fast growing, reproduce rapidly, and have few predators or natural controls in their new environments.

“Our department works tirelessly to prevent the spread of these pests, but getting everyone involved in prevention and detection is key to the fight against invasive species,” said Steve Carlson, MDARD’s Pesticide and Plant Pest Management Division Director.

Wildlife Forever Announces Winners of Songbird Art Contest

White Bear Lake, MN – Wildlife Forever, in partnership with the USDA Forest Service, is proud to announce the winners of the 3rd annual Art of Conservation Songbird Art Contest®. The contest brings awareness to the importance of songbirds and their critical conservation needs. A panel of judges from across the conservation industry selected state and national winners from over 2400 entries.

This year’s contest featured the Northern Cardinal, the Painted Bunting, the Chestnut-collared Longspur, the Red-winged Blackbird, and the Yellow-throated Warbler. After students select and research their species, they create both an artistic rendition and a piece of creative writing. Read more
